How do you handle demanding and high-stress situations in the workplace?

INTERMEDIATE LEVEL
How do you handle demanding and high-stress situations in the workplace?
Sample answer to the question:
In demanding and high-stress situations in the workplace, I tend to stay calm and focused. I prioritize tasks and create a plan of action to ensure everything gets done efficiently. Communication is key during these times, so I make sure to keep open lines of communication with my team and relevant stakeholders. I also find it helpful to take short breaks and practice deep breathing or meditation techniques to relieve stress. Additionally, I don't hesitate to ask for help or delegate tasks when necessary. Overall, my ability to stay composed, communicate effectively, and manage my time well allows me to navigate demanding situations successfully.
Here is a more solid answer:
In demanding and high-stress situations in the workplace, I have developed effective strategies to ensure smooth operations. Firstly, I prioritize tasks and create a detailed plan of action, taking into account the urgency and importance of each task. This helps me stay organized and ensure that critical tasks are addressed promptly. I also believe in open and transparent communication during these times. I keep all relevant stakeholders informed about the situation, potential obstacles, and progress made. This ensures everyone is on the same page and can contribute their expertise towards resolving the issue. Additionally, I am not afraid to ask for help or delegate tasks when necessary. I understand that collaboration is key to handling high-stress situations, and utilizing the strengths of the team can lead to better outcomes. Furthermore, I value self-care and stress management techniques. During intense moments, I take short breaks to rejuvenate and practice deep breathing exercises. This allows me to regain focus and maintain a clear mind. Finally, I believe in being flexible and adaptable to the changing needs of the work environment. I understand that unexpected challenges can arise, and I am prepared to adjust my plans and strategies accordingly.
Why is this a more solid answer?
The solid answer provides specific strategies and examples of how the candidate handles demanding and high-stress situations. It discusses the candidate's ability to prioritize tasks, communicate effectively, delegate, and ask for help. Additionally, it mentions the importance of stress management and self-care. The answer also addresses the candidate's flexibility and adaptability in responding to unexpected challenges.
An example of a exceptional answer:
In demanding and high-stress situations in the workplace, I have developed a comprehensive approach that allows me to thrive and lead my team effectively. Firstly, I recognize the importance of preparation. As an Occupational Health Nurse, I regularly review and update emergency response plans, ensuring that all necessary equipment and supplies are readily available. This proactive approach minimizes panic and enables a swift and efficient response to emergencies. Additionally, I prioritize building strong relationships with my colleagues and stakeholders. By fostering a culture of trust and open communication, we are better equipped to collaborate and problem-solve effectively even in high-stress situations. I also understand the significance of self-care. Alongside practicing stress management techniques, I schedule regular check-ins with myself to assess my mental and emotional well-being. This enables me to maintain a healthy work-life balance and brings a positive energy to my team. Furthermore, I embrace continuous learning and staying updated on the latest industry practices. This enables me to stay ahead of potential issues and implement preventative measures. Lastly, my ability to remain calm under pressure and make well-informed decisions allows me to lead my team confidently and efficiently through demanding situations.
Why is this an exceptional answer?
The exceptional answer goes above and beyond by providing a comprehensive approach to handling demanding and high-stress situations. It emphasizes the candidate's preparedness and proactive nature in reviewing emergency response plans. The answer also highlights the importance of building strong relationships and practicing self-care. Additionally, it discusses the candidate's commitment to continuous learning and ability to remain calm and make informed decisions in high-pressure situations.
How to prepare for this question:
  • Familiarize yourself with the organization's emergency response plans to demonstrate your proactive approach.
  • Reflect on past experiences where you successfully handled high-stress situations and come prepared with specific examples to showcase your abilities.
  • Practice effective communication techniques, both verbal and written, to ensure clear and concise communication during stressful times.
  • Develop stress management strategies that work for you, such as deep breathing exercises or mindfulness techniques, and incorporate them into your daily routine.
  • Stay updated on industry best practices and regulations related to occupational health and safety to demonstrate your commitment to continuous learning.
  • Highlight your ability to remain calm and make well-informed decisions by discussing relevant experiences in your response.
What are interviewers evaluating with this question?
  • Stress management
  • Time management
  • Communication
  • Ability to prioritize
  • Ability to delegate
  • Ability to ask for help
  • Flexibility/adaptability
